Angela talks to peptide expert Kyal Van Der Leest, about the fascinating world of peptides and their powerful effects on health and wellness. They delve into the science behind peptides, explaining what they are and how they function in the body, with a focus on popular peptides like BPC-157 and GHK-Cu.
Kyal shares insights on how these peptides can aid in healing, enhance recovery, and support collagen production, particularly for those dealing with gut health issues or aging concerns.
